How to Convert an Improper Fraction to a Mixed Number. Divide the numerator by the denominator. Write down the whole number result. Use the remainder as the new numerator over the denominator. This is the fraction part of the mixed number. Example: Convert the improper fraction 16/3 to a mixed number. Divide 16 by 3: 16 ÷ 3 …

To convert a decimal to a fraction, write the decimal as a fraction with the decimal number as the numerator and a power of 10 as the denominator, depending on the number of digits after the decimal point. Then, simplify the fraction by dividing both the numerator and denominator by their greatest common factor.Step 1. Assign the decimal number to some variable, say \hspace {0.2em} x \hspace {0.2em} x. "Percent" means "per 100" or "over 100". To convert 3.25% to a decimal rewrite 3.25 percent in terms of per 100 or over 100. 3.25 over 100 is the same as 3.25 divided by 100. Check relevant local regulations for appropriate sizes, spacings and all ...First of all, rewrite the given decimal number. Divide it by 1: 2.625 will be changes into 2.625 / 1. Now we have to multiply both the numbers by 1000 as after decimal there are 3 digits. It will eliminate the decimal: 2.625 / 1 ×1000 / 1000 = 2625 / 1000. Fraction to Decimal Examples. Here are a few examples to demonstrate how the Fraction to Decimal Calculator works: Example 1: Converting a Proper Fraction. Let’s convert the fraction 3/4 into a decimal. To do this, divide the numerator (3) by the denominator (4). The result is 0.75.
